Our telly (Samsung UE55F8000) is connected to a Yamaha YSP2200 sound bar via HDMI. If I use the Netflix app that's built into the TV, I don't get Dolby 5.1 via the ARC.

Would using an optical cable from the TV to the soundbar give me DD5.1 from Netflix?

When Netflix app is running: TV Menu > Sound > Additional Sound Settings > Dolby Digital 5.1 / DTS
